Schedule for UP NEET Counseling in 2023 to be Announced Soon; Check List of Government Medical Colleges

The Uttar Pradesh National Eligibility Entrance Test (UP NEET) 2023 counseling schedule will shortly be announced by the Directorate of Medical Education and Training (DMET). The official UP NEET website, upneet.gov.in, will publish the counseling schedule for the MBBS and BDS programs. This year, counseling will be held for the allocation of 85% of the seats.

Three rounds, including a mop-up round, would be used for the UP NEET UG admissions. Any seats that are unfilled in the first round will be carried over to the second. According on the results of the NEET 2023 exam, students will be admitted to MBBS or BDS programs at medical institutes.

UP NEET UG COUNSELING: REGISTRATION INSTRUCTIONS

Step 1: Access atupneet.gov.in, the official website.

The second step is to choose the “Registration UG (MBBS/BDS)” link from the site.

Step 3: A fresh login page will open, requiring you to provide information such as your course information, roll number, NEET application number, and captcha code.

Step 4: Give the application some thought and pay the necessary amount.

Step 5: Review all the information, complete the form, and get the admissions confirmation page.

It is crucial to be aware that applicants must pay a non-refundable application fee of Rs. 2000 in order to take part in the counseling round. Once registration is complete, applicants must fill out and lock their selections.

Candidates must bring their NEET admit card and rank card, Class 10 and 12 transcripts, a valid photo ID, a UP domicile certificate, a caste certificate (if applicable), an online registration slip, and a receipt for the security deposit to the designated institutions for verification in order to be considered for admission to the UP NEET 2023. Seat forfeiture might occur if there is non-compliance. These materials should be prepared in advance by candidates.
